DINERS CLUB Sample Clauses
The Diners Club clause establishes the terms under which Diners Club credit cards are accepted as a method of payment. Typically, this clause outlines the procedures for processing Diners Club transactions, any applicable fees, and the responsibilities of both the merchant and the cardholder. For example, it may specify how refunds are handled or what happens in the event of a disputed charge. The core function of this clause is to ensure clarity and mutual understanding regarding the use of Diners Club cards, thereby reducing the risk of payment disputes and facilitating smooth financial transactions.
DINERS CLUB. At CCC's request, Bank will participate in the licensing program of Diners Club for each Processor bank number of CCC's so requested. Bank will settle Diners Club in the same manner as Visa and MCI as described in this Agreement. Any Merchant may apply to CCC to process Diners Club card Transactions. If approved and the Merchant enters into a Merchant Agreement for the Diners Club program, CCC and Bank will supply Diners Club processing and settlement services in accordance with the terms of the Merchant Agreement and the Diners Club operating regulations.
DINERS CLUB. If settlement services are provided for Diners Club (“Diners”) transactions:
(i) Customer shall retain Diners sales drafts and Diners credit vouchers for a period of at least 90 days from the date of the Diners transaction, and Customer shall retain microfilm or legible copies of Diners sales drafts and Diners credit vouchers for a period of at least seven years following the date of transaction.
(ii) Customer shall not accept a Card embossed “for local use only” outside the territory in which it was issued; and
(iii) Customer shall not accept an Amoco co-branded Card unless Customer has a specific contractual agreement authorizing Customer to do so.
